flow流量采集的数据处理方法有哪些?
在当今信息化时代,数据已成为企业运营和决策的重要依据。其中,流量数据作为衡量网络访问量和用户行为的关键指标,对于企业来说至关重要。然而,如何有效处理流量采集的数据,成为了一个亟待解决的问题。本文将探讨flow流量采集的数据处理方法,旨在为相关从业者提供有益的参考。
一、数据预处理
在处理流量数据之前,首先需要进行数据预处理。数据预处理主要包括以下步骤:
- 数据清洗:对采集到的流量数据进行清洗,去除无效、重复、错误的数据,确保数据的准确性和完整性。
- 数据转换:将原始数据转换为适合后续分析的数据格式,如将时间戳转换为时间序列数据。
- 数据归一化:对数据进行归一化处理,消除数据量级差异,便于后续分析。
二、数据存储
数据存储是流量数据处理的重要环节。以下是一些常用的数据存储方法:
- 关系型数据库:如MySQL、Oracle等,适用于结构化数据存储。
- NoSQL数据库:如MongoDB、Cassandra等,适用于非结构化数据存储。
- 分布式存储系统:如Hadoop HDFS、Alluxio等,适用于大规模数据存储。
三、数据挖掘与分析
数据挖掘与分析是流量数据处理的核心环节。以下是一些常用的方法:
- 统计方法:如描述性统计、相关性分析、回归分析等,用于分析流量数据的整体特征和趋势。
- 机器学习方法:如聚类、分类、关联规则挖掘等,用于发现流量数据中的潜在规律和模式。
- 可视化分析:将流量数据以图表、图形等形式展示,直观地展示数据特征和趋势。
四、案例分析
以下是一个流量数据处理案例:
案例背景:某电商平台希望通过分析用户浏览行为,提高用户体验和转化率。
数据处理步骤:
- 数据采集:通过网页分析、日志分析等方式采集用户浏览行为数据。
- 数据预处理:对采集到的数据进行清洗、转换和归一化处理。
- 数据存储:将预处理后的数据存储到Hadoop HDFS上。
- 数据挖掘与分析:利用机器学习方法对用户浏览行为数据进行聚类分析,识别用户兴趣和偏好。
- 可视化展示:将分析结果以图表形式展示,便于运营人员了解用户行为,优化产品和服务。
五、总结
flow流量采集的数据处理方法主要包括数据预处理、数据存储、数据挖掘与分析等环节。通过合理的数据处理方法,企业可以更好地了解用户行为,优化产品和服务,提高运营效率。在实际应用中,企业应根据自身需求选择合适的数据处理方法,并结合案例分析,不断优化数据处理流程。
猜你喜欢:零侵扰可观测性